Noob smoker here. Tried my hand at an old bullet smoker for a few years and just never got the hang of it. So when our last grill died, it was right by my birthday and I talked the wife into a Traeger for my gift (as well as my Father's Day gift and maybe even Christmas!). She was reluctant but knows about these pellet smokers and how awesome they are, so it showed up a few day before my birthday!
I've smoked and grilled on it numerous times so far. It's awesome!!!
What kind of pellets do you folks recommend I use? I've heard that Traeger pellets are no good (why?), but when I used the BBQ Delights on Fathers Day, I had two MAJOR flare-ups. After which I made the mistake of turning the grill off (fire started making its way up my auger tube).
I don't want to blame the pellets, but the only differences from previous smokes/BBQs I'd done on the Traeger, was the pellets and the fact that I was smoking ribs (first time on the Traeger). Any help would be appreciated. Thanks!
